About Me

I was born in a rich agricultural area in Kitale, Kenya. I went to local schools in my area and after that I joined the University of Naiorobi in Kenya where I studied Environmental and Biosystems Engineering. From a rural setting and managing to rich the University in a country where there is high level of poverty and my parents struggling to pay my fees; is something am proud of.

I started my business of manually making briquettes using hands because I was disturbed by the wanton destruction of our forests by charcoal burning and wanted to make a difference.When I was growing up, there were several forests in our locality especially natural trees but now days the story is different.We are heading towards low forest cover against the stipulated world standard.

I am passionate about new ideas and technological advancement that protect the environment in a sustainable way.swimming and reading on topical issues are my key hobbies.

My Business

After working for several organisations,I challenged myself to be an entrepreneur.I looked around my environment, saw the destruction of forests and decided that I have to be the change I want to see.Trees were being cut to meet domestic fuel and in some instances industrial production.This destruction prompted me to act.

I partnered with my brother and started making briquettes using hands.In a day,we are able to get one bag of 50kg.The demand in our market center alone is approximately 500 bags a month.

I intend to fabricate a manual briquetting machine from local available materials so that I can increase my production capacity. I target a production capacity of 4 bags of 50kg a day.This translates to approximately 100 bags of 50kg a month. selling a bag at the current rate of USD 10,the business will fetch USD 1000 month.The operational costs anticipated are to the tune of USD 600.This leaves us with a profit of USD 400.The business is self sustainable and breaks even in two month and can comfortably repay the loan.

Currently I make USD 260 which I share with my brother.We each take home USD100 month to meet our personal effects and USD 6 caters for operational costs of the business.

Loan Proposal

Once I acquire the loan, I intend to buy materails for making manual briquetting machine.The loan will carry out the following:
-buy a press@ USD20
- 13 feet 3 inch steel bar@USD25
-10feet 2 inch steel bar @USD 10
-8 feet 1 inch steel bar@USD 8
-5feet by 5 feet metal sheet@USD 17
-Drum for carbonising@USD 20
-Welding costs@USD50

TOTAL COST IS USD 150

With these materials and after fabricating the manual briquette,I hope to increase my production capacity from 25 bags of 50kg a month to 100 bags of 50kg a month.This will help me meet part of the demand in my local market and reduce the destruction of trees because my briquettes are using agricultural and forest waste.

My profit will increase from USD200 to USD 400.This will go along way in improving my living study,my brother and my whole family.The impact the loan will create will be huge to me and the community around me.The profit raised can be reinvested in the business, used for expansion and in the long term,meet demand in my locality and other parts of the country
